Summary

The June 1999 version of the HP-UX aserver program allows local users to gain privileges by specifying an alternate PATH which aserver uses to find the awk command.

Risk Assessment

This vulnerability may lead to unauthorized access to the system, posing a serious security threat to the organization.

Recommendation

It is recommended to update the aserver program to the latest version and restrict local users' ability to modify the PATH variable.
